Germany's Support for Ukraine
Germany's support primarily comes in the form of humanitarian aid, financial assistance, and military equipment. This includes everything from providing essential supplies to funding reconstruction projects. Military equipment is a key aspect, as Germany has supplied Ukraine with various defensive weapons, vehicles, and ammunition. However, this doesn't necessarily mean boots on the ground.
The Role of Military Advisors and Trainers
One area where German military personnel might be present is in advisory and training roles. It's common for countries to send military advisors to help train Ukrainian soldiers on using the equipment provided. These advisors aren't frontline combatants; instead, they focus on imparting knowledge and skills to the Ukrainian armed forces. Think of it like sending coaches to help a sports team improve their game. The coaches aren't playing, but they're crucial for the team's success. The presence of these advisors is usually part of a bilateral agreement between Germany and Ukraine, aimed at enhancing Ukraine's defense capabilities. This kind of support aligns with international law and is a standard practice among allies.

The Official Stance: No Combat Troops
The official position of the German government has consistently been that they will not send combat troops to Ukraine. This stance aligns with Germany's broader policy of avoiding direct military intervention in the conflict. Instead, Germany focuses on providing support through other means, such as financial aid and military equipment, as mentioned earlier. This approach is designed to help Ukraine defend itself without escalating the conflict into a broader international war.
Why This Stance?
There are several reasons behind Germany's decision not to send combat troops. Firstly, there's a historical context to consider. Germany has a complex history with military involvement in Eastern Europe, particularly during World War II. This history shapes its current foreign policy and contributes to a cautious approach to military deployments. Secondly, there are political considerations. Public opinion in Germany is divided on the issue of military intervention, and the government must consider these views when making decisions. Thirdly, there are strategic reasons. Germany believes that providing support through other means is more effective and less escalatory than sending combat troops.

NATO and Collective Security
NATO plays a crucial role in the security landscape of Europe. As a member of NATO, Germany is committed to the principle of collective defense, which means that an attack on one member is considered an attack on all. This commitment is enshrined in Article 5 of the NATO treaty, as mentioned earlier. However, NATO's involvement in the conflict in Ukraine is limited, as Ukraine is not a member of the alliance. NATO provides support to Ukraine through various means, such as providing equipment and training, but it avoids direct military intervention to prevent escalating the conflict into a broader war between NATO and Russia.

Economic Considerations
The conflict in Ukraine has also had economic consequences for Germany. The war has disrupted supply chains, increased energy prices, and created uncertainty in the global economy. Germany has taken steps to mitigate these effects, such as diversifying its energy sources and providing financial support to businesses affected by the conflict. However, the economic impact of the war is likely to be felt for some time to come. The economic considerations are very important for the german government to take into account.
